切换测试环境而已,真的不需要那么麻烦

前面我们都在讲接口测试接口文档,这一期讲讲如何切换测试环境。

设置 API 的请求地址前缀、全局变量信息。在测试时,可以一键切换测试环境而不需要手动输入域名。

我们可以通过环境下拉框新增环境。
切换测试环境而已,真的不需要那么麻烦_第1张图片

我们可以通过切换测试环境对 API 实现以下操作:

  • 修改请求地址 URL
  • 通过全局变量动态改变所有 API 的请求信息,例如 Query、 Body等参数
    切换测试环境而已,真的不需要那么麻烦_第2张图片

前置URL

在测试时我们只需要选中相应的请求地址,测试时域名就会自动加到 API 路径前面,可以通过切换环境快速对开发、测试、线上环境的 API 进行测试

切换测试环境而已,真的不需要那么麻烦_第3张图片

在 API 文档或测试中使用的方式引用环境变量,在发送请求时会自动将环境变量替换为响应的值。

环境变量

环境变量常用语以下场景:

  • 通过环境变量改变 API URL 里面的版本路径,比如 api.eoapi.com/user/login
  • 改变请求参数的 Key 和 Value, 比如表单中有一个参数的 version,值是环境变量:

切换测试环境而已,真的不需要那么麻烦_第4张图片

EOAPI 是一个开源的 API 管理工具,除了最常用的文档测试功能,一些新的功能也在不断地被添加进来。当然,如果你觉得它还不够满足你的需求,你有什么好的想法,不妨去 Github 上提个 issue, 项目开发人员都会及时回复的。

该项目也有完整的开发文档,如果你有什么技术问题,也可以去交流, PM 也会及时回复。

github 地址:https://github.com/eolinker/e...
Eopai 官网地址:https://www.eoapi.io/?utm_sou...

你可能感兴趣的:(切换测试环境而已,真的不需要那么麻烦)